7 Lesser Known Facts About Bappi Lahiri

Indian singer-composer Bappi Lahiri passed away today at the age of 69 after being hospitalized for a month. The actor has given us several hit songs.

Bappi Lahiri is one of the most celebrated artists in the music industry. Let’s take a look at the 7 Lesser Known Facts About Bappi Lahiri.

1-  His Real Name Was Alokesh Lahiri

Bappi Lahiri was born in Calcutta as Alokesh Lahiri. His family had a rich history in classical and traditional music.

2- He Started Playing Tabla at 3

Bappi Lahiri started playing Tabla at 3. He was trained by his parents Aparesh and Bansuri Lahiri.

3- He was related to Kishore Kumar

Kishore Kumar is Bappi Lahiri’s maternal uncle. They have worked on many albums and songs together such as Zakhmee (1975), Chalte Chalte (1976), and ‘Inteha Ho Gayi’.

4- He Sued American R&B Singer Truth Hurts for Copying His Music

Bits of Lahiri’s song ‘Thoda Resham Lagta Hai’ was used in Truth Hurts’ ‘Addictive’Bappi Lahiri then sued the artist in a Los Angeles court that rule in Lahiri’s favor. All sales of the song’s CDs were halted until Lahiri was given credit.

5-  His Song ‘Jimmy Jimmy’ Was Appreciated Globally

‘Jimmy Jimmy’ from Disco Dancer was the song that gained Lahiri several accolades internationally. It was recreated for the Hollywood film You Don’t Mess With the Zohan. The song was featured towards the end of the film.

6- The Singer Owned More Than 75 Kgs of Gold

We know Bappi Lahiri for his obsession with gold. He believed that gold was his lucky metal. The singer was also seen with 7-8 gold chains, bracelets, and rings on him. In 2021, he bought a gold tea set on Dhanteras.

7- Elvis Presley Was His Styling Inspiration

Bappi revealed his love for Elvis Presley’s styling in ‘Indian Idol Season 12’. He said that Elvis is his styling inspiration and how he combined it with his own love for gold.
